 Normally, painting a ceiling a dark hue creates the illusion of a 
smaller room, but there's so much natural light in this space that it 
works. Here's how: The many white accents give that light something to 
bounce off of, while the natural jute rug gives warmth, and the feathers
 add a much-needed textural lightness. The result? Stark contrasts gone 
cool. (
